Output 5896ff6895b340c44a031ae26fda70b83776b4a4da96aa02babdb4006a391522:5

value
3609400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27a20812fa90f4b80292738e4952cecca2414bf6 OP_EQUAL
address
35JaPB3Bg8zz4RJvKkM5hG4vQMmH2NKnsS
transaction
5896ff6895b340c44a031ae26fda70b83776b4a4da96aa02babdb4006a391522
confirmations
78778
spent
true